The impressive accommodation in brief comprises:
A large entrance porch with two side facing UPVC entrance doors, providing ample space for seating and also currently doubles up as a study area. A generously proportioned living room which has large aluminium bi-folding doors opening onto the stunning raised decked patio and takes in views over the lovely rear garden, a further adjacent rear facing UPVC window is enjoyed as well as a stylish contemporary wall mounted living flame electric fire. The spacious kitchen boasts a comprehensive range of attractive fitted wall and base units in high gloss grey which incorporate a built-in double oven and induction hob with stainless teel extractor hood above, beautiful worktops and splashbacks, plumbing and space for a washing machine and dishwasher, space for a tumble dryer and also space for a large American style fridge freezer. The room opens out to the conservatory which provides excellent dining space and is UPVC double glazed to all 3 sides with a side facing UPVC glazed French door which gives access on to the attractive private front garden, the room also has stylish slate effect wall tiles. The inner hallway has a built in understairs cupboard, side facing UPVC window and stairs leading to the first floor.
To the first floor is a spacious landing area which has doors opening in to all 3 bedrooms and family bathroom and has a built in storage cupboard. Bedroom one is an impressive Master bedroom which has a front facing UPVC window enjoying views over the quiet cul de sac and attractive fitted wardrobes across one wall, the room also benefits from an ensuite which comprises of a low flush WC, pedestal wash hand basin, shower cubicle and side facing obscure glazed UPVC window. Bedroom two is a further sizeable double bedroom which has a rear facing UPVC window taking in views over the attractive rear garden. Bedroom three is a further bedroom with rear facing UPVC window overlooking the rear garden. The family bathroom is beautifully tiled with a suite comprising of a low flush WC, wash hand basin and bath with shower above and shower screen, the room benefits from two obscure glazed UPVC windows.
Exterior, to the front of the property is a block paved driveway which provides off-road parking, to the side of which is an attractive enclosed garden which is accessed from the conservatory and provides a beautiful place to sit and catch the sun. To the rear of the property is an impressive and sizable raised decked patio which is accessed from the lounge, beyond which is a good size lawned garden which includes a variety of mature trees, plants and shrubs which provide a beautiful leafy aspect and ensure a good level of privacy.
Notes
The property has active planning permission for a ground floor extension 22/02857/FUL. The property also had planning permission which has recently lapsed for a double storey extension 18/02571/FUL.
